Q: Is 396,273 a Prime Number?
A: No, 396,273 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 396273 can be evenly divided by 1 3 31 93 4,261 12,783 132,091 and 396,273, with no remainder.
Since 396,273 cannot be divided by just 1 and 396,273, it is not a prime number.
